7th Annual Don Baker Banked Slalom

March 4, 2023 @ 8:00 AM 5:30 PM

Boise’s favorite snowboard event is back for its 7th year! The Legendary Don Baker Banked Slalom is an amazing event in memory of an outstanding and influential individual in the local community. Come celebrate the sport of snowboarding and the life of a local legend, by strapping in and pointing it to the finish line.

The course is hand dug by volunteers and terrain park staff. Featuring steep pitches, tight turns, and rollers. This course never disappoints and if you are interested in helping build the course, please reach out on Facebook, Instagram (@bogusbasinterrainparks), email: corey@bogusbasin.org
